Tensions rise/ Thailand bombs border area with Cambodia

Thailand has carried out air strikes in a border area with Cambodia as officials from both sides continue talks to end the fighting. The Thai Air Force said it had struck a fortified Cambodian military position after civilians had fled the area.

Cambodia's Defense Ministry accused Thailand of indiscriminate attacks on civilian homes and injuring several people.

Fighting flared up again earlier this month after a fragile ceasefire in July ended five days of fierce border clashes. At least 41 people have been killed and almost a million others displaced since hostilities resumed.

Both countries have blamed each other for breaking the ceasefire. Since then, fighting has spread to almost every province along the 800-kilometer border.

Cambodia's defense ministry said Friday's attacks took place in the northwestern province of Banteay Meanchey. Up to 40 bombs were dropped by F-16 fighter jets, the ministry said in a statement. Thailand said the operation was aimed at controlling the village of Nong Chan and was carried out efficiently and successfully.

This came as Thai and Cambodian negotiators held a third day of talks at a border checkpoint. Defense ministers from both sides will join the discussions on Saturday.

Thai Prime Minister Anutin Charnvirakul said on Friday that once both sides agree to each other's terms, a ceasefire agreement could be signed.

"I hope this is the last time we will have to sign, so that peace can happen in the area and people can return to their homes," he said. 

The US and China have also tried to broker a new ceasefire. The dispute between Thailand and Cambodia dates back more than a century and has seen sporadic clashes, with soldiers and civilians killed on both sides over the years.

But in May, tensions escalated after a Cambodian soldier was killed in a clash. And on July 24, the situation escalated dramatically after a Cambodian rocket attack on Thailand, which was followed by Thai airstrikes. This triggered five days of fierce fighting, which left dozens of soldiers and civilians dead. /CNA
